1. The Geodynamo and the Myth of Geological Slowness

In standard textbook geophysics, geomagnetic polarity reversals—where Earth’s magnetic North and South poles invert—are described as agonizingly slow, millennia-long geological processes taking between 4,000 and 10,000 years to complete. However, recent paleomagnetic analyses of ancient basalt lava flows in Steens Mountain, Oregon, and sediment cores from the Laschamp Excursion (41,000 years ago) suggest that the dipole field collapse can occur with shocking rapidity: dropping by up to 90% in strength over a matter of decades.

Earth’s magnetic field is generated by the geodynamo: the turbulent convective circulation of molten nickel-iron in the outer core 2,900 kilometers beneath our feet. When convective heat flows become chaotic, the dominant axial dipole field unravels. If a geomagnetic reversal compressed its transitional collapse into a single ten-year window today, it would not trigger earthquakes or physical crustal shifts—it would unleash an invisible, atmospheric and electromagnetic catastrophe for modern high-technology human civilization.

2. The Multipole Chaos and the Collapse of the Shield

During a rapid reversal, the magnetic field does not simply switch off and on. Rather, the clean, stable dipole field dissolves into an erratic multipole complex. Earth would temporarily possess four, six, or eight chaotic magnetic poles simultaneously.

Navigational compasses would spin uselessly, with magnetic north migrating hundreds of miles per month across populated continents. Concurrently, overall field strength plummets to less than 10% of its normal 50 microtesla intensity. The Van Allen radiation belts—which trap lethal solar protons and electrons thousands of kilometers above Earth—deflate down to the upper stratosphere. Auroras (the Northern Lights) would no longer be confined to the Arctic circles; blinding, incandescent neon-green and blood-red auroral curtains would light up the night skies over Cairo, Mexico City, Mumbai, and Singapore.

4. Biological Navigation Disruptions and Human Adaptation

Beyond technology, the animal kingdom would experience immediate disarray. Millions of migratory species—sea turtles, homing pigeons, monarch butterflies, whales, and migratory birds—rely on cryptochrome proteins in their eyes and magnetite mineral crystals in their beaks to navigate via Earth’s magnetic lines. An erratic multipolar field would disrupt global migration flyways, causing mass strandings and ecological collapses.

For human beings, a decade-long magnetic transition would necessitate subterranean or radiation-shielded lifestyle adjustments. To survive during periods of intense solar proton storms, societies would have to ground long-distance air travel, harden electrical substations with Faraday shielding, and construct localized micro-grids.
